Emergency Care
Seizures, deep wounds, and breathing difficulties signal life-threatening emergencies that demand immediate veterinary attention. Unlike urgent issues such as vomiting or limping, true emergencies like animal bites or heatstroke can quickly become fatal without proper care. These critical situations require rapid assessment and treatment to ensure your pet’s survival.
Available during regular business hours, emergency care at our Elk Grove animal hospital handles both life-threatening crises and urgent non-emergency conditions. Prevention strategies – including proper outdoor supervision, secure leash walking, and storing household toxins safely – significantly reduce emergency visits to Stonelake Animal Hospital. Regular wellness exams and up-to-date vaccines also help catch potential problems before they become emergencies.

Microchipping
Tiny electronic devices no bigger than rice grains provide permanent identification that stays with your pet forever. Unlike collar tags that break or fall off, microchipping offers reliable protection when pets bolt through doors or escape from leashes. Stonelake Animal Hospital performs this quick, minimally invasive procedure between the shoulder blades using a sterile syringe.
Registration after implantation remains critical – unregistered microchips become worthless for reuniting lost pets with families. Veterinarians and shelters at our Elk Grove animal hospital scan found animals to access the owner’s contact information stored on the chip. Keeping registration details current ensures successful reunions when your companion goes missing.
Pet Orthopedics
Arthritis, hip dysplasia, and cruciate ligament injuries cause pain and mobility issues in pets. X-rays help diagnose bone, joint, and muscle problems affecting your companion’s quality of life. Pet orthopedics treats conditions from fractures to genetic issues like luxating patella.
Physical therapy and weight management resolve mild orthopedic conditions without surgery. Stonelake Animal Hospital performs cruciate repairs and fracture stabilization at our Elk Grove animal hospital when needed. Post-treatment rehabilitation restores mobility through targeted exercises and lifestyle adjustments.

How often should I bring my pet for routine examinations?
Most adult dogs and cats benefit from annual wellness visits that include preventive care assessments and vaccine status updates. Senior pets over seven years old typically need examinations every six months to monitor age-related health changes. Our Elk Grove animal hospital’s veterinary team will recommend a personalized schedule based on your pet’s age, health history, and specific medical needs.
